Post by OhioCanGuy »

nocheins wrote: Thu Sep 03, 2020 12:56 pm POC Flat from Columbus; bottom opened and looks A+; jaw dropping $478. What a difference a mandatory makes...and no longer a sleeper..
Big number for sure.

I have a really nice example of this can on my shelf. However, this one would have been an upgrade, so I was interested in picking it up. In the final 20 seconds or so, the bid was still $138-ish. Figured I'd throw in a bid just over $300, would likely get the can and sell my downgrade. The perfect plan!

Before I could enter my bid, it went crazy and was over $400. I backed off as clearly someone else wanted it more than me.

Two observations:

1. There were three unique bidders over $400
2. The high bidder upped his bid near the end. So whatever his max bid originally was, he upped it again to be sure he won the can. Would love to know that number.
Bob

Post by OhioCanGuy »

Summitcan wrote: Sun Jan 10, 2021 9:58 pm I do not doubt the value of this can .. not a Goebel expert ,
How does this rank among Goebel smalls ?
$ 962.00
https://www.ebay.com/itm/Bantam-Ale-by- ... true&rt=nc
Bantam.jpg
Thanks
I remember watching this auction and my jaw about hit the floor when the final result was posted. Since ebay now collects sales tax for most states (44 of the 50 and counting), the buyer likely paid over $1k for this can.

Not too many years ago you could buy a clean one of these for $250ish, maybe even less.

Condition is the new rarity.
